The best way to find a cheap train ticket from Reading station (RDG) to Southampton Airport Parkway (SOA) is to book your journey as far in advance as possible and to avoid travelling at rush hour.
The average ticket from Reading station (RDG) to Southampton Airport Parkway (SOA) will cost around £21 if you buy it on the day, but you can find cheap train tickets today for only £12.
Of the 5 trains that leave Reading station (RDG) for Southampton Airport Parkway (SOA) every day 5 travel direct so it’s quite easy to avoid journeys where you’ll have to change along the way.
These direct trains cover the 63 km distance in an average of 1 h 16 m but if you time it right, some trains will get you there in just 43 m .
The slowest trains will take 1 h 34 m and usually involve a change or two along the way, but you might be able to save a few pennies if you’re on a budget.
